About the role

The Senior Director of Integrated Supply Chain will lead strategic sourcing, procurement, and demand planning across the Menomonee Falls, WI organization. This role will ensure material availability, optimize supplier performance, and align supply chain strategy with business objectives in a highly regulated, mission-critical environment.

Responsibilities

  • Develop and execute end-to-end supply chain strategies focused on buying, planning, and inventory optimization
  • Align procurement and planning functions with corporate growth, cost, and operational goals
  • Lead transformation initiatives to modernize supply chain processes and systems
  • Establish sourcing strategies for critical components, including long-lead and high-spec naval materials
  • Negotiate complex contracts with key suppliers to ensure cost competitiveness and risk mitigation
  • Drive supplier performance management, including quality, delivery, and compliance
  • Ensure accurate demand forecasting and supply planning across multiple programs
  • Optimize inventory levels while maintaining high service levels and program readiness
  • Collaborate with engineering, production, and program management to align supply with project timelines
  • Implement KPIs and dashboards to monitor supply chain performance
  • Drive continuous improvement initiatives across procurement and planning functions
  • Leverage digital tools (ERP, APS systems) to enhance visibility and decision-making

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Supply Chain, Engineering, Business, or related field (MBA preferred)
  • 15+ years of progressive supply chain experience, including senior leadership roles
  • Strong background in procurement, buying, and capacity planning
  • Experience in defense, naval, aerospace, or complex manufacturing environments strongly preferred
  • Working knowledge of CPSR, DFAR/FAR compliance, and documentation for DoD contractors
  • Proven success leading S&OP/IBP processes
  • Deep knowledge of ERP systems (SAP, Oracle, or similar)
  • Strong negotiation, analytical, and leadership skills
  • U.S. Citizenship required
